Episode 17: The virtual learning boom, and what comes next

The Idaho Virtual Academy was providing online education before the pandemic, serving some 1,700 K-12 students pre-pandemic.

By fall 2020, enrollment had mushroomed to more than 3,800 students.

To look back at the boom, and look at the prospects for 2021-22, we interview Kelly Edginton, the head of school at the academy.
